What strain is it? Northern Light Auto
Is it Indica, Sativa or Hybrid? What percentages? According to the seed bank it should be Sativa 0% Indica 80% Ruderalis 20%
Is it in Veg or Flower stage? Mid-to-late Flowering stage
If in Flower stage... For how long? 8 weeks
Indoor or outdoor? Indoor
If indoor...Dimensions (L x W x D) of grow space? 60x60x140
Soil or Hydro? Soil
If soil... what is in your mix? Plagron Growmix
If soil... What size pot? 3 Liter
Size of light? HID 250W
Is it aircooled? No
Temp of Room/cab? 23/24C° day, 18/19C° night
RH of Room/cab? 45%
PH of media or res? 6.2Ph
Any Pests ? Thrips once flowering started. Cured with some sticky yellow paper, it seems that there are no more of them
How often are you watering? By the time of writing the water assumptions has lowered a lot. Typically 1.5 L every 2-3 days (I use a soil probe to determine when the soil tend to be dry. I also "weight" the pot to "feel" if it's dry or not
Type and strength of ferts used? Advanced Nutrients - GROW(1-0-4), MICRO (2-0-0), BLOOM (1-3-4)

I lately recognized a nitrogen deficiency during the 4th week of flowering (recognized by the typical claw leaves) and I had also a thrips infestation that should be under control now but, to be honest, i'm not able to say that is 100% true.
Anyway 2 days ago the tips of the leaves manifested the typical nutrient burn black tip, and I found out that my drain water ppm was over 2000 (a little bit high, right?) and Ph, like, 7/7.2.
I flushed the medium, lowering ph to 6 and ppm to 1000.
